Non-equilibrium in the Cell

An important concept in studying metabolism and energy is that of chemical equilibrium. Most chemical reactions are reversible. They can proceed in both directions, releasing energy into their environment in one direction, and absorbing it from the environment in the other direction. The same is true for the chemical reactions involved in cell metabolism, such as the breaking down and building up of proteins into and from individual amino acids, respectively. Automated Microbial Diagnostics

Automated diagnostic analyzers have transformed clinical microbiology by providing rapid and reliable methods for pathogen identification and antibiotic susceptibility testing. 科学领域:

  • 临床实验室科学 临床实验室科学
  • 医疗人工智能的人工智能

背景情况:

  • 实验室医学越来越自动化.
  • 人工智能 (AI) 正在获得优化实验室工作流程的吸引力.
  • 有限的批准的人工智能模型存在,具有成本和准确性等缺点.

研究的目的:

  • 审查人工智能在实验室医学中的现状.
  • 确定人工智能实施的挑战和解决方案.
  • 探索人工智能在临床测试中的未来机会.

主要方法:

  • 关于人工智能在实验室医学中的应用的文献评论.
  • 在临床使用和新兴研究中分析AI模型.
  • 讨论挑战,解决方案和未来的前景.

主要成果:

  • 人工智能可以优化实验室的工作流程,并有可能彻底改变这个领域.
  • 目前的人工智能模型存在一些局限性,包括成本,准确性和需要手动审查.
  • 该审查涵盖了临床试验的各个阶段的AI应用.

结论:

  • 人工智能有望促进实验室医学的发展.
  • 应对当前的挑战对于更广泛的AI采用至关重要.
  • 未来的研究应该专注于提高人工智能的准确性,成本效益和整合.
